W. Wolff is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Spectroscopy and Computational Mechanics. According to data from OpenAlex, W. Wolff has authored 95 papers receiving a total of 811 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 78 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 39 papers in Spectroscopy and 22 papers in Computational Mechanics. Recurrent topics in W. Wolff’s work include Atomic and Molecular Physics (67 papers), Mass Spectrometry Techniques and Applications (36 papers) and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(30 papers). W. Wolff is often cited by papers focused on Atomic and Molecular Physics (67 papers), Mass Spectrometry Techniques and Applications (36 papers) and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(30 papers). W. Wolff coll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, Germany and United States. W. Wolff's co-authors include H. Luna, E. C. Montenegro, A. C. F. Santos, M. P. Stöckli, H. M. Boechat‐Roberty, N. V. de Castro Faria, Felipe Fantuzzi, C. L. Cocke, E. Y. Kamber and Marco Antônio Chaer Nascimento and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Physical Review Letters and The Journal of Chemical Physics.
